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ort is to bus via Queensway Q1 which costs £17 - £35 and takes 5h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ort is to drive which takes 2h 35m and costs £35 - £55.
No, there is no direct bus from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ort. However, there are services departing from Town Centre South and arriving at Celtic Manor & ICC via North Terminal Bus Station and Friars Walk 6.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 33m.
The distance between Crawley and Celtic Manor Resort is 172 miles. The road distance is 148.7 miles.
The best way to get from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ort without a car is to train which takes 3h 53m and costs £50 - £190.
It takes approximately 3h 53m to get from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ort, including transfers.
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ort bus services, operated by National Express, depart from North Terminal Bus Station.
The best way to get from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ort is to train which takes 3h 53m and costs £50 - £190.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£26 - £70 and takes 5h 33m.
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Kingsway K14 station.
Yes, the driving distance between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ort is 149 miles. It takes approximately 2h 35m to drive from Crawley to Celtic Manor Resort.
What companies run services between Crawley, England and Celtic Manor Resort, Wales?
You can take a train from Three Bridges to Celtic Manor Resort via Farringdon, Farringdon Without, London Paddington, Newport (S Wales), Friars Walk 6, and Celtic Manor & ICC in around 3h 53m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from North Terminal Bus Station to Kingsway K14 hourly. Tickets cost £24–65 and the journey takes 3h 40m.
